Thalassemia screening strategies

Abstract:

Objective To investigate the roles of mean corpuscular volume(MCV) determination,mean corpuscular hemoglobin(MCH) determination and hemoglobin(Hb)electrophoresis in thalassemia screening.Methods A total of 1 017 patients with thalassemia diagnosed by molecular biologic technique(thalassemia group) and 842 patients without thalassemia(control group) were enrolled for MCV and MCH determinations and Hb electrophoresis. The roles of MCV determination,MCH determination and Hb electrophoresis in thalassemia screening were evaluated.Results The levels of MCV and MCH in thalassemia group were lower than those in control group(P<0.05). Compared with control group,the levels of HbA2 were higher in β- and αβ-thalassemia groups and lower in α-thalassemia group(P<0.05). The level of HbF in β-thalassemia group was higher than that in control group(P<0.05). There was no statistical significance between static-type α-thalassemia and control groups(P>0.05). The levels of Hb,MCV,MCH and HbA2 were lower in light-type and intermediate-type α-thalassemia groups compared with control group(P<0.01). In α-thalassemia group,MCV determination and Hb electrophoresis had high rates of missed diagnosis. The rates of missed diagnosis were 42.38% for MCV determination,41.56% for Hb electrophoresis and 18.38% for MCH determination. The rates of missed diagnosis of MCV determination,MCH determination and Hb electrophoresis were 64.20%,22.19% and 59.47% in static-type α-thalassemia group and 14.12%,12.98% and 19.47% in light-type α-thalassemia group,respectively. The sensitivities of MCV determination,MCH determination and Hb electrophoresis were 68.34%,83.09% and 74.72%,and the specificities were 82.30%,68.17% and 74.11%,respectively. The sensitivity of MCV and MCH parallel determinations was 83.28%,and the specificity of the combined determination of MCV and MCH parallel determinations with Hb electrophoresis was 85.04%.Conclusions MCV and MCH parallel determinations can improve the sensitivity,and the combined determination of MCV and MCH parallel determinations with Hb electrophoresis can improve the specificity in thalassemia screening.
